Dodgers eye trade for Cardinals closer Riley O'Brien ahead of deadline
Summary

The Los Angeles Dodgers are considering a trade for St. Louis Cardinals closer Riley O'Brien as the MLB trade deadline approaches. O'Brien, currently with a career-high 22 saves this season, would provide much-needed support for a Dodgers bullpen that has been plagued by injuries. The Dodgers, who are leading the league in wins, may also pursue Detroit Tigers pitcher Tarik Skubal to strengthen their rotation. O'Brien, 31, has four years of club control remaining, making him a valuable target for teams looking to enhance their pitching staff.
